Hello plugin authors,

Next Thursday, Corbexa will run a disaster-recovery drill for the RestockRoute vending-machine restock planner. During the failover window, plugin callbacks will be replayed against the standby scheduler, so please ensure your handlers are idempotent and tolerate duplicate route assignments. No customer restock data will be altered. To re-register your plugin against the standby environment during the drill, authenticate with the recovery passphrase provided below.

vault phrase of hahip-tajeg = quenax-briath-briax

## Tuning

The Wrenhall audio-guide app prefetches exhibit tracks over gallery Wi-Fi, which degrades badly near the Atrium of Maren wing. If visitors report stalls, adjust the prefetch depth and retry backoff before touching the CDN settings — past incidents were almost always client-side. Restart the fleet after any change. The current production tuning constants are listed below.

tuning table, faduf-baduf:
PRIORITIES = {
    "ulavan": 191,
    "silys": 750,
    "goriel": 238,
    "kelmir": 66,
    "wendor": 432,
}

- [ ] Step 7: Archive cold storage buckets (Glacierline tier). Confirm both ceremony witnesses are present, verify bucket manifests match the Oxbow ledger, then seal the archive key shares. Plugin authors may observe but not handle shares. Once sealed, the archive index itself is encrypted and can only be reopened with the passphrase below.

vault phrase of badup-hahig = tamael-aldael-kelmir-istael-fenok-istwyn-tamius-jorath-oliion

**Mgmt Meeting Minutes — Retiring the Brightline Range**

Quick recap for sales leads at Fenholt Supplies: we agreed to retire the Brightline fixture range by year-end. Remaining stock moves to clearance pricing next month, and accounts on standing orders get migrated to the Lumetta range. Trade-in incentives were approved in principle. The confidential note on next steps sits just below.

board note of bajof-bajeg: The pricing group signed off on a budget of $13.4 million for Project Sildor. The renewal with Lamixek Holdings closes at $48.9 million a year, 49 percent above the last contract.